Your Guide to Finding the Perfect Firm Mattress
Choosing a new mattress can feel like a big job. You want something that supports your body well and helps you sleep soundly. If you know you need a firm feel, this guide will help you pick the best one. A firm mattress offers strong support, which is great for many sleepers.
Key Features to Look For
When shopping for a firm mattress, keep these important features in mind:
- Support Core Strength: This is the main part of the mattress. A strong support core keeps your spine straight. Look for high-density foam or many coils.
- Minimal Motion Transfer: If you share your bed, you don’t want to feel your partner move. Firmer mattresses often block movement better than very soft ones.
- Edge Support: Good edge support means the sides of the mattress won’t sag when you sit on them. This makes getting in and out of bed easier.
- Durability Rating: Check reviews for how long the mattress keeps its shape. A quality firm mattress should last many years without losing its support.
Important Materials in Firm Mattresses
The materials inside the mattress greatly affect how firm it feels and how long it lasts.
Innerspring (Coil) Mattresses
These use metal coils for support. Firmer innerspring mattresses often have thicker, more tightly packed coils. This design naturally creates a very supportive, bouncy feel.
High-Density Foam Mattresses
Foam mattresses use layers of different foams. For firmness, you need high-density polyfoam or supportive latex. These materials push back against your weight strongly. Memory foam can be used, but it must be a very dense type to feel truly firm.
Hybrid Mattresses
Hybrids mix coils (for support) and foam/latex (for comfort layers). A firm hybrid will have a strong coil base and only a thin, firm comfort layer on top. This offers the best of both support and some pressure relief.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Not all firm mattresses are made the same. Some factors really boost the quality:
- Higher Density = Better Quality: In foam mattresses, higher density foam resists body impressions better. Low-density foam breaks down fast, making the mattress feel uneven sooner.
- Coil Count and Type: More coils usually mean better support, especially in innerspring and hybrid models. Pocketed coils (where each coil is wrapped) generally offer better contouring than traditional interconnected coils.
- Warranty Length: A long warranty (10 years or more) suggests the manufacturer trusts the materials used. Poor quality materials might only come with short warranties.
Sometimes, a mattress might feel firm but be low quality. If the top comfort layer is too thin, you might feel the hard support core right away. This creates uncomfortable pressure points, even if the mattress is technically labeled “firm.”
User Experience and Best Use Cases
Firm mattresses are not for everyone, but they work perfectly for certain groups.
Who Benefits Most?
- Back Sleepers: People who sleep on their back need their hips and shoulders to stay level with their spine. A firm surface prevents the hips from sinking too far.
- Stomach Sleepers: If you sleep on your stomach, a soft mattress causes your stomach and hips to dip. This strains your lower back. Firm support keeps your body aligned.
- Heavier Individuals: People with higher body weights often need the extra support a firm mattress provides to prevent excessive sinkage.
If you have shoulder pain or primarily sleep on your side, a mattress that is too firm might cause pressure points on your shoulders and hips. In those cases, a “medium-firm” might be a better compromise.
10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) About Firm Mattresses
Q: How can I tell if a mattress is truly firm?
A: Check the firmness scale, usually rated 1 to 10 (10 being the firmest). Look for ratings of 7 to 9. Also, read user reviews specifically mentioning how it felt right out of the box.
Q: Will a firm mattress hurt my back?
A: If you have back pain, a mattress that is too soft is often the problem. A firm mattress supports proper spinal alignment, which usually relieves pain. However, if it is *too* hard, it can cause new pressure points.
Q: Is a firm mattress hotter than a soft one?
A: Generally, no. Heat retention depends more on the material. Foam mattresses trap heat, but innerspring and hybrid models allow for better airflow, regardless of firmness level.
Q: How long does it take to get used to a firm mattress?
A: Most people adjust within a week or two. Your body needs time to adjust to the new, correct sleeping posture.
Q: Do firm mattresses cost more?
A: Not necessarily. The price depends on the material quality (like high-density foam or pocketed coils), not just the firmness level.
Q: Can I make my current soft mattress feel firmer?
A: Yes, you can use a firm mattress topper made of dense foam or latex. This is a budget-friendly option before buying a whole new bed.
Q: What is the best firmness for side sleepers?
A: Side sleepers usually prefer medium-firm (around 5 or 6). A very firm mattress might not cushion the hips and shoulders enough.
Q: Are firm mattresses good for couples with different preferences?
A: A high-quality hybrid rated medium-firm is often a good compromise. It provides enough support for a back sleeper while offering a bit more cushion for a side sleeper.
Q: What is the difference between firm foam and firm innerspring?
A: Firm foam contours slightly to your body shape, offering pressure relief. Firm innerspring offers more bounce and very direct, stable support with less contouring.
Q: Should I look for a trial period when buying firm?
A: Absolutely. Since firmness is personal, always choose a brand that offers at least a 100-night sleep trial. This lets you test the support in your own home.
